            I think you want something that optimizes the size of a box that will contain other boxes - rather like a sheet cutting optimizer to ensure minimal waste of a sheet of material cut into your sub-pieces...

            It wouldn't be that difficult IF the sub-shapes were 'boxes' - it they're not then it could use their bounding boxes but that wouldn't always be efficient. There's no built in 'clash-detection'... Is the optimization to be on total volume or plan size of the containing box ?
